Preflight checks
U.S. Air Force Tech. Sgt. Mathias Hauser, 41st Rescue Squadron special missions aviator out of Moody Air Force Base, Ga., inspects the rotor blades of an HH-60G Pave Hawk May 6, 2014, at Flagstaff Pulliam Airport, Ariz. Hauser and his air crew operated the HH-60 during Angel Thunder, an exercise that provides personnel recovery and combat search and rescue training for combat air crews, pararescue, intelligence personnel, battle managers and joint search and rescue center personnel.
